GAOA Palisades Lagoon Liner & Sprinkler System Replacement, Coronado National Forest
The project involves the Palisades Lagoon & Sprinkler System Replacement, which includes maintaining and upgrading the wastewater treatment system at the Palisades Administrative Site. Work entails replacing the existing lagoon liner and effluent sprinkler system, reconstructing access roads, and installing a temporary wastewater conveyance system to ensure uninterrupted service during construction. Performance will take place at the Palisades Administrative Complex on the Santa Catalina Ranger District of the Coronado National Forest, Pima County, Arizona, approximately 20 miles from Tucson.
